Ocean Wall Mural at the Dauphin Swimming Pool

We're huge fans of street art and wall murals that we spot while traveling around. We try to highlight these works of art as often as possible on the travel blog. The most recent one that we spotted was painted on the side of the wall of the Dauphin Swimming Pool building in Dauphin, Pennsylvania. 

The wall mural takes up the entire side of the building. It was hard to get it all in one photograph due to the cars parked in the parking lot. On top of that, we had just rained making things slippery and wet. I was looking for an artist's signature or company who had painted it, but couldn't find one. I'll have to do a little research to obtain that information. 

Ocean Wall Mural at the Dauphin Swimming Pool

Artistically it depicts and underwater ocean them with sea turtles, jellyfish, dolphins, clam shells, coral, seaweed, and a small school of fish in the top left corner. Very colorful, so it looks like it was painted recently, within the past 1-2 years or they take really good care of it! If you look close you can spot the door to the building in the center of the mural underneath the welcome.

To the right of the building you'll find the fenced-in inground swimming pool that is used by the local residents in Dauphin. You have to pay for a yearly membership or pay by the day (according to a local resident who spoke with us). 

the Dauphin Swimming Pool in Dauphin, Pennsylvania

Other than this one wall mural, we spotted no other murals or fun street art while driving around the borough of Dauphin in Pennsylvania. With that said, we really enjoyed seeing it.

Family Dining at the Olive Garden in Harrisburg

Olive Garden in Harrisburg

The Olive Garden Italian Restaurant is a chain-style restaurant that you'll find across the United States. They're known for their casual dining, family atmosphere, and authentic Italian foods. Recently our family visited the one located at 5102 Jonestown Road in Harrisburg. 

If you plan on visiting...we do recommend that you try to visit during off-peak hours. This location gets extremely busy and often times we have to wait 40-60 minutes to be seated if we go during the weekend or weekday evenings when they're busy. This is especially true if there are 5 or more in your dining party.

Olive Garden in Harrisburg

Their menu offerings are vast offering all kinds of pasta dishes, soups, salads, appetizers, and desserts. They do offer a few items in the kid's section of the menu. Their portions are always generous in size. If you enjoy having alcohol with your meal...they offer alcoholic beverages too. 

As you can see from our photos...we had 12 people in our dining party with 4 of them being children. It took 45 minutes for us to get seated. Once we placed our orders it was another 40-45 minutes until our main meals hit the table. Like I said, if they're busy it will take awhile. If you're looking for quick, in and out dining...choose off-peak hours or a different restaurant. 

Olive Garden in Harrisburg

Everything that we ordered was delicious. The hot foods were hot and the cold foods were cold. No mistakes were made on our large order at all. Our waitress was attentive and took care of all of our refills and needs in a timely manner. Gotta love great wait service! We showed our appreciation by letting a hefty tip for the great service.

Hassles Mini Golf and Ice Cream Parlour in North Wildwood

Hassles Mini Golf and Ice Cream Parlour in North Wildwood

Miniature Golf is an activity that our entire family enjoys doing. We get together several times a year to play at home and/or while traveling. Wildwood has a lot of great courses to play at but one of our favorites is Hassles located in North Wildwood, right off of the beach. 

Hassles offers their own on-site ice cream parlour, bike rentals, and an 18-hole mini golf course. They're open seasonally throughout the year. There's a small area to park that's free if you're visiting their establishment. 
Hassles Mini Golf and Ice Cream Parlour in North Wildwood

The course is beautifully landscaped with fun and interesting layout. It's a fairly easy couse to play with most adults in our party getting a par 2 or par 3 on every hole. It as a tad more challenging for the kids that were with us that day. 

We like to visit during off-peak hours when it's not crowded but yet avoid the middle of the day heat. If you want to avoid crowds go earlier in the day or at dinner time when other families are out to eat. You'll want to wear comfortable walking shoes and you can bring along your own water bottle to stay hydrated. 
Hassles Mini Golf and Ice Cream Parlour in North Wildwood

According to the rules you get 5 strokes per hole. After 5 you get a penalty on your scoring. They will give you a scorecord when you pay...along with golf clubs and balls. The scoring is located on the scorecord if you're new to the game. There are stationary and moving obstacles to keep the course challenging and fun.

It took our party of 4 about 40 minutes to go through the entire course. We took our leisurely time and had 2 adults and 2 children playing. If it's not crowded and just all adults you could get through the course quicker. 
Hassles Mini Golf and Ice Cream Parlour in North Wildwood

Once we were done we headed inside to the Hassles Ice Cream Parlour. You'll find ice cream cones, dishes, sundaes, and milkshakes. They have a lot of flavors to choose from. Everything was delicious and frankly...the prices were affordable too! We had a great time while we were there!

Anastasia The New Broadway Musical at the Hershey Theatre

Anastasia The New Broadway Musical at the Hershey Theatre

Last week we went to the Hershey Theatre to see Anastasia the New Broadway Musical and had a wonderful time. Every 2-3 months we like to go down to see a show and are never disappointed. Why travel up to NYC when we can drive 15 minutes to Hershey and enjoy an off-Broadway show? It's just as nice! 

Anastasia is presented by NETworks Presentations, book by Terrence McNally, Music by Stephen Flaherty, and lyrics by Lynn Ahrens.

Anastasia The New Broadway Musical at the Hershey Theatre

The talented cast includes: Kyla Stone, Sam McLellan, Ben Edquist, Gerri Weagraff, Bryan Seastrom, Madeline Raube, Mikayla Agrella, Addison Kiyomi Au, Lance Timothy Barker, Dakta Hoar, Madeline Kendall, Lizzy Marie Legregin, Colby Marie Lewis, Victoria Madden, Elizabeth Ritacco, Lathan A. Roberts, Alexandrya Salazar, Sarah Statler, Lauren Teyke, and Aidan Ziegler-Hansen. 

First Act lasts for about 1 1/2 hours or just a little shy of that...then a 15-20 minutes intermission, and then the second act which is a little over an hour in length. I like to let everyone know how long a show is, so they can plan for it accordingly in their schedule. 

Anastasia The New Broadway Musical at the Hershey Theatre

While you're at the Hershey Theatre you can purchase snacks, beverages and alcoholic drinks (with proper ID), along with souvenirs from the show such as t-shirts, socks, hats, etc. The souvenirs can be pricey and there's not a lot to choose from. We typically just get a beverage while we're there.
